What are best temporary jobs?

'Best Temporary' jobs refer to short-term or contract positions that are considered especially desirable due to their pay, flexibility, work environment, or potential for skill development. These roles can range across industries, including administrative work, events, hospitality, and seasonal retail, and are often sought by people looking for quick employment, career changers, or those seeking work-life balance. The 'best' temporary jobs typically offer competitive wages, flexible schedules, and may even provide a pathway to permanent employment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ary employee?

To thrive as a Temporary Employee, you need adaptability, a quick learning ability, and basic competence in the relevant field or industry, often supported by a high school diploma or relevant experience. Familiarity with office software, customer management systems, or industry-specific tools may be required depending on the assignment. Strong communication, reliability, and a positive attitude help temporary staff integrate quickly and contribute effectively to diverse teams. These skills ensure that temporary employees can efficiently fill gaps, support operations, and add value during short-term assignments.

What are some common challenges faced by temporary employees, and how can they overcome them?

Temporary employees often face challenges such as adapting quickly to new work environments, learning company processes on short notice, and building relationships with permanent staff. To overcome these obstacles, it's beneficial to be proactive in asking questions, taking detailed notes during training, and demonstrating flexibility. Engaging with colleagues and seeking feedback can also help you integrate faster and perform effectively, potentially opening doors for longer-term opportunities.

Role Overview:
Educational Assistants provide a range of support services that help students to achieve their academic, social, physical and personal potential. Educational Assistants assist students with intensive needs in five key areas, providing personal care, life skills and experiences, academic support, communication, and behavioural support as required by students and directed by teachers, to promote engagement, participation and success in school.
What you will do:





  • Provide personal care to students to maintain their dignity and promote independence.ย  Personal care may include catheterization, administration of medication, oxygen monitoring, gastronomy tube feeding, changing student briefs, supporting toileting, and other procedures outlined in the student accommodation plan.
  • Assist and coach students to develop the skills and abilities they need to succeed in their daily lives and help prepare students for life after high school.
  • Work under the direction of the administrator, classroom teacher and student services teacher to promote student engagement in learning and provides academic support as defined by teachers, including small group/one on one reinforcement activities and clarifying/assisting with assignments.
  • Support up to date and complete student programming records by documenting progress on targeted goals in the Inclusion and Intervention Plan and other reporting, and participates in parent-student-teacher conferences when requested by the parent or administrator.
  • Promote, facilitate and model positive behaviour interventions and supports to encourage, support, reinforce and facilitate appropriate and positive student behaviour and social interactions, guided by Safety and Behaviour Plans where applicable.
  • Work in collaboration with the students' team to ensure learning occurs in the least restrictive environment and encourages/facilitates peer group interaction and participation in learning and other school activities.
  • Perform other duties as may be required or assigned by the School Administrator.
